Berriedale is a tiny estate town on the northern eastern coastline of Caithness, Scotland, on the A9 road in between Helmsdale and also Lybster, near the limit in between Caithness and Sutherland. It is sheltered from the North Sea. The town has a parish church in the Church of Scotland. Simply southern of Berriedale, on the way to the north, the A9 passes the Berriedale Braes, a high decrease in the landscape (brae is a Scots word for hill, a borrowing of the Scottish Gaelic bràighe). The road drops down steeply (13% over 1,3 km) to bridge a river, before rising again (13% over 1,3 kilometres), with a variety of sharp bends in the roadway-- although a few of the hairpin bends and also various other neighboring slopes have been alleviated in recent years. The impracticality (and expense) of linking the Berriedale Braes prevented the building of the Inverness-Wick Far North Line along the east shore of Caithness; instead the train runs inland through the Flow Country. Berriedale is located at the end of the 8th stage of the seaside John o' Groats Trail.

FAQs

what is sewer?

Sewer is simply a set of pipes or drains that’s usually underground and whose primary function is to remove waste water as well as other waste materials. Generally, there are three main types of modern sewer systems and they include sanitary sewers ( also commonly referred to as foul sewers), storm sewers or surface water sewers as well as combined sewers. Now let’s take a look at each of the sewer types!

  • Sanitary sewers or foul sewers. These are the sewer systems that are mainly incorporated to transport waste water and other waste matter from both homes and businesses to waste water treatment plants. Normally, they include pipes, manholes as well as pumping stations. Their function is, however, not only to carry waste water to treatment plants, but also to maintain the water quality as this is essential for public health. Here, gravity is commonly used to remove the waste water. However, in low lying areas, pumps can be incorporated especially when the waste water needs to reach an area that’s at a higher elevation
  • Storm sewers or surface water sewers. The primary function of this sewer system is to carry rain water as well as melting snow ( unlike sanitary sewers that are designed to carry waste water) from the roofs and roads and then direct it straight into the streams, rivers and also other water bodies. These sewer systems can get clogged with leaves, litter and other debris which can ultimately lead to flooding.
  • Combined sewer. As the name suggests, these sewers are combined. This implies that the make use of a single pipe to carry both waste water and storm runoff water to wastewater treatment plants. These aren’t very common anymore as the sewer can overflow especially when there’s a lot of rain which makes the system incapable to handling both the waste water and surface water.
how deep is a main sewer line buried?

Before you start digging, you should know sewer lines are required to be buried within certain specifications and it’s your responsibility to find out what these specifications are. If you’re thinking about the appropriate depth of sewer line, then you’ve come to the right place! In this post we’re going to consider how deep a main sewer line should be buried underground.

First and foremost, you should understand that sewer lines are simply the intestinal systems of a house or property. Their primary function is to totally remove waste water and other waste matter from your drains, toilet, shower, dishwasher as well as the exterior faucets. With this in mind, we can then move to our main concern which is the sewer line depth. In a world that’s perfect, you’d be allowed to to just dig your home’s sewer line deep enough to cover it with a thin layer of sod. However, if you happen to reside in an environment with deep running cold, this inclement weather may just freeze up your waste right in the pipe due to the fact that it’s placed too close to the surface where there’s not enough warmth. This could also extend to other harsh weather conditions such as heavy wind and hurricanes which are able to tear out ground deep down and even more so, if it were to pull up trees that are close by with deep roots. Hence, the need to get the appropriate depth of sewer lines right.

Sewer lines depth can vary greatly - they can be as shallow as 12 to 30 and can be as deep as 6+ feet. This is often determined by the climate.

How do I fix a blocked drain?

Depending on the size and location of the blockage, a blocked drain may be fixed by simply removing the build-up. This can be done either by using drain cleaner or physically removing the blockage. If the blockage is very serious or located within the pipes themselves, you will need to contact a plumber.

how much to unblock an outside drain?

Do you think your outside drain is blocked? If yes, then you should have it treated as soon as possible and most especially by a professional who can guarantee the best outcome. When you fail to unblock your drain when due, there is no limit to the damage that can be caused. These includes water leakages which can damage your home or business facility. And in critical situations, it can as well result in pipe burst which will definitely cost you a lot more money to fix when compared to taking a quick action to unclog the outside drain blockages. If you’re thinking about hiring a professional, then you’d probably want to know how much its going to cost. In this post, we’re going to look at the cost of clearing an outside drain and the possible influencing factors.

The cost of clearing an outside drain is based on a number of factors. These factors include the type of the blockage, the method used, the location of the property as well as the ease of access. Using the blockage type as an example, a small blockage in a toilet or sink is usually priced within the range of £50 to about £70. However, for an extensive blockage deep in your outside drain that’s hard to access, you may end up incurring anything within the range of £150 to about £200.

There are also a wide variety of methods that can be used to clear blockages from an outside drain which will also play a key role in the final cost of the service. These methods include drain jetting which usually costs within the range of £70 to £175, drain rodding from £80 to about £145 as well as a full system scrub which should cost about £150 to £200.

It is, however, important to note that the above costs are just an estimate and other factors as mentioned earlier on will also have an influence on the final price.
